Item Acesso aberto (Open Access) Análise de estoque do processo produtivo utilizando inferência fuzzy para tomada de decisão : estudo de caso(Universidade Federal do Pará, 2021-07-15) CARVALHO, Pablo Rock Dias; MAGNO, Rui Nelson Otoni; http://lattes.cnpq.br/9017163598972975The objective of the work is to propose a methodology for stock assessment and decision making in a phyto cosmetics company, using fuzzy logic. In this case study, we tried to answer the level of production and, consequently, the reasonableness of the stock. Such AI technique was chosen because it is the most suitable for better decision making. With the results obtained by the simulation with the real data, it was possible to verify that using the fuzzy logic technique the decision making had a greater precision for the applied scenario and this will bring benefits to the company, as well as the minimization of storage costs and weekly production beyond what is necessary. The present study aims to: identify and model the inventory control processes that already exist in the company, analyze the inventory that already exists in the company, describe the methodology for inventory control and propose actions of the methodology that allow the corrections of inventory activities already identified. Therefore, propose a methodology for optimizing stock control that is able to define how much and when to buy the products. Aiming at the development of this dissertation, the execution of the work was divided into the following four stages: data collection, process mapping, analysis of improvement opportunities and implementation of improvement proposals. The implementation of the methodology produced a decrease of 30% in the problems of non-attendance. Resulting in positive factors such as lean inventory, efficient customer service, increased capital turnover and increased company profits.
